Supply Chain Manager

Post date: 27/04/2024

Closing date: 25/05/2024

Location: Norwich, Norfolk, England

Internal job ref: LJ1003216250

Status: Full Time

We are currently seeking an experienced Supply Chain Manager to join our procurement team in Norwich. The role involves maximizing supplier effectiveness and value across our portfolio, including Daily Delivery & Quality measurement, SLA adherence, and performance initiatives. Reporting directly to the Group Supply Chain Director

Responsibilities:

-          Develop positive relationships with suppliers.

-          Act as an escalation route and communication channel for colleagues and suppliers.

-          Create reports on SLA performance, cost, and continuous improvement.

-          Implement vendor management strategies.

-          Collaborate with stakeholders to provide support and training.

-          Drive implementation of third-party supplier controls.

-          Monitor key performance indicators to ensure targets and budgets are met.

-          Lead and develop team members.

Requirements:

-          Experience in supplier relationship management.

-          Understanding of contract management.

-          Management experience.

-          Budget management skills in multi-site environments.

-          Experience in dispute management.

-          Six Sigma training preferred.

-          Proficiency in ERP systems; knowledge of JDE Edwards and advanced Excel skills advantageous.
